Description
This procurement is advertised as a 100% HUB-ZONE SET-ASIDE. The U. S. Army Corps of Engineers, New Orleans District, has a requirement for various investigations, studies, environmental studies and activities. The Corp intends to award an two Inde finite Delivery/Indefinite Quantity contracts with a base and two option periods, as a result of this solicitation. The award will be based on the best value to the Government, considering price and other factors. Proposals will be rated according to the following evaluation factors: 1. Technical Experience  a. Offeror shall identify work experience of all personnel who have performed work similar in scope to that identified in the RFP b. Previous experience of organization and key personnel working together on projects of similar scope and magnitude c. General knowledge and experience in the arena of formulation studies and alternatives; water resource projects; incremental cost analyses; data inventory assessment and analysis; planning studies and facilitation; master planning; Brownfield redevelopment; water resources data management; and public involvement 2. Professional Qualifications  a. Education of key personnel b. Experience of key personnel in performing work in related fields. 3. P ast Performance  Demonstrate past performance, knowledge, and geography of New Orleans District locality in working with the Corps of Engineers, other Federal, Local, and State Agencies in similar type projects. The offeror should have experience with da ta needs/inventory assessment and analysis; Brownfield redevelopment; water resources data management; public involvement; multi-media environmental and occupational safety and health compliance audits/assessments; preparation of complete or partial Enviro nmental Impact Statements (EISs), Environmental Assessments (EAs), Environmental inventories and related special studies documentation; Geographic Information (GIS, and Remote Sensing (RS) capabilities; hazardous waste inventories and recovery plans; cultu ral resourcws investigations; air emission inventories, permit applications, and conformity analyses; storm water pollution prevention planning; pollution prevention opportunity assessments, baseline environmental/humal health risk assessments; Aquatic and ecosystem restoration studies and plans, endangered species compliance; Wetland studies and reports and other scientific and technological investigations to accomplish the mission and complete environmental assignments. Work shall involve multi-disciplin ary environmental investigations and other studies for any of a variety of Federal military and civil work entities.
